Substitute Eggs Powder. Whisk together two tablespoons of water, one teaspoon of oil (like corn or vegetable oil) and two teaspoons of baking powder. Find out how each option. One serving of this mixture is equivalent to one missing egg. For recipes that use eggs as a binder or for moisture, substitutes like applesauce or oil can do the trick.
